Program overview

The oral session will be devoted exclusively to the invited speakers. They are currently Aka, F.T. (IRGM, Cameroon), Bernard, A. (Univ. Libre Bruxelles, Belgium), Delmelle, P. (University of York, UK), Notsu, K. (University of Tokyo, Japan), Ohba, T. (TITech, Japan), Saito, G. (AIST, Japan), Shinohara, H. (AIST, Japan), Tanyileke, G. (IRGM, Cameroon), Taran, Y. (UNAM, Mexico), Varekamp, J.C. (Wesleyan University, USA), and Yokoyama, T. (University of Maryland, USA). Other contributions will be presented by posters. At the seminar, a special talk by Minoru Kusakabe, who has been working in geochemistry of crater lakes and magmatic-hydrothermal systems, is planned, for he is retiring from ISEI at the end of March 2006. Tentative program:
Monday, 27th February 2006
Time Speaker Titile of paper
08:00 Registration desk opens.
09:00 Kusakabe, M. Opening: About AASPP-Misasa.
09:10 Varekamp, J.C. (to be announced)
09:35 Delmelle, P. The environmental fate of volcanic emissions.
10:00 Saito, G. Magma degassing of Satsuma-Iwojima volcano: Constraints from melt inclusions, volcanic gases and petrology.
10:25 Coffee break
10:50 Shinohara, H. Magmatic degassing during mild-Strombolian activity of Villarrica Volcano, Chile.
11:15 Notsu, K. "Visible degassing vs. invisible degassing" during magmatic evolution.
11:40 Taran, Y. Nitrogen and argon in volcanic and hydrothermal gases. Implications for the volatile budget in subduction zones.
12:05 Lunch
13:30 Ohba, T. Volcanic hydrothermal system of Mt.Kusatsu-Shirane Japan, hosting the active crater lake Yugama.
13:55 Bernard, A. The monitoring of volcanic lakes in Indonesia: from ground to space measurements.
14:20 Yokoyama, T. Melting processes beneath Mt. Cameroon: Constraints from U-Th-Ra and Sr-Nd-Pb isotope systematics.
14:45 Coffee break
15:15 Aka, F.T. The age of Lake Nyos, Cameroon, using U-Th-Ra disequilibria.
15:40 Tanyileke, G. The rationale for degassing Lakes Nyos and Monoun.
16:05 Kusakabe, M. Lakes Nyos and Monoun, Cameroon: the beginning, present and future.
